Dad found a box of my grandfather's folding knives this morning. All the usual suspects are there, including 2 Buck 110's. But one of them has the name upside down. ??? knockoff?
Buck, Buck, Puma, Craftsman
Linerlocking slipjoint Schrade
Sodbuster Jr with 8dots. That means 80's production, right? Anyway, I have since cleaned this one up and sharpened it, and it's going to ride in my left-front for a while.
Another Buck 301, to go with the other that dad gave me last year.
Big 2-bladed Western 062. The lack of a letter after the model should mean that this one is Pre-1973
5" bladed Camillus 9. I keep being drawn to this knife more than any other from the box. It makes me smile to know that over 13 years ago, my Papaw sharpened this knife by hand, and it is still shaving sharp with his own edge on it.
